Job description

Reporting to the President of the parent organization, the General Manager will be responsible for the overall leadership and performance of our client’s business, with full accountability for operational excellence, financial results, commercial growth, customer satisfaction, and organizational capability. The General Manager will develop and execute the business strategy, ensure safe and efficient operations, drive profitable growth, and build a high-performing team while aligning the business with broader strategic objectives.The General Manager will be accountable for:

  • Shaping the work environment and delivering standards of excellence and quality to customers across products and services.
  • Crafting a strategic vision, driving optimized productivity through operational and sales strategies, and establishing clear accountabilities.
  • Marshalling resources to achieve financial targets, including revenue, sales margins, and EBITDA.
  • Developing high-performing talent and strengthening the capabilities of the broader team.
  • Fostering an engaged workforce through initiatives that elevate the employee experience and, in turn, the customer experience.
  • Improving organizational effectiveness by fostering a culture of continuous improvement and accountability, developing effective processes, and implementing innovative changes.
  • Identifying opportunities for expansion and growth through new business relationships and commercial initiatives.
  • Leading the end-to-end supply chain, including procurement, production planning, inventory management, warehousing, logistics, and maintenance, while maximizing operational performance and asset utilization.
  • Providing guidance and feedback to strengthen team capabilities and performance.
  • Maintaining a strong commitment to a healthy and safe working environment.

As a senior leader within the broader organization, the General Manager is expected to actively engage with peers and colleagues in broader strategic organizational initiatives. The General Manager will serve as a change agent for organizational initiatives and projects, providing support, direction, and leadership within the business and across the broader organization.

The ideal candidate is an accomplished business leader with experience leading a business unit within a larger animal health, pharmaceutical, specialty chemical, or life sciences organization. They possess a strong commercial mindset, an understanding of chemistry-based products and regulated markets, and a proven ability to identify, develop, and commercialize new business opportunities that drive profitable growth and market diversification.
